Hi i m waiting for a stable N3DSxl downgrade method; but meanwhile there is a lot to catch up as i was using a lazy sky3ds :).
If i understand correctly, emunand is just an untouched sysnand (at higher version or not) on the sd card while so called CFW like rxtools are a stub of code located in launcher.dat . Upon boot a boot exploit/entrypoint (coldboot ??) is launched that execute launcher.dat and this one acts like a bootloader that will patch signature and so on in the emunand firmware / system menu.

Am i right ?

How would I go about unlinking my nand without Gateway? Sorry again if this has a trivial answer.
How to unlink nands:
1. In sysnand, go to System Settings -> Other Settings -> Format System (Do not accept yet)
2. Eject your Sd card (don't worry, it is safe)
3. Accept to Format your 3DS/2DS (let it connect to the internet if it asks, it will not update your system)
4. After it reboots, go through the setup screen and set everything up
5. Once in the home menu, insert back your sd card and let it create some files on your sd card.
6. Your nands are now unlinked, and there are 2 ID folders in your Nintendo 3DS folder on your SD card (one for emunand, another for sysnand)

How it will look on your SD card:
jI44.png


The folder with the smallest size belongs to your sysnand, since you just formatted it. Grab the database zip again and put the title.db and import.db in YourSysnandFolder/RandomNumbersAndLettersFolder/dbs, just like you did in Step 1: Line 1 & 2! Don't forget to go to Data Management in Sysnand to let the 3DS "repair" your software management information!
